Abstract

<B>"NOVO SISTEMA ATIVADOR PARA COMPOSTOS DE METALOCENO"<D>. Aluminoxanos contendo grupos alquil C~ 2~-C~ 10~ podem ser convenientemente usados em composições catalíticas suportadas de polimerização de olefina preparadas por contato de um suporte compreendendo um composto sólido que é um óxido de alumínio puro, um óxido de alumínio misto, um sal de alumínio, um haleto de magnésio, ou um haleto de magnésio C~ 1~-C~ 8~ alcoxi, em qualquer ordem com pelo menos: a) um composto organometálico da fórmula geral (1): <B>R1MX~ v-1~<D> em que cada R é o mesmo ou diferente e é um grupo alquil C~ 1~-C~ 10~; <B>M<D> é um metal do Grupo 1, 2, 12 ou 13 da Tabela Periódica; cada <B>X<D> é o mesmo ou diferente e é um de um átomo de halogênio, um átomo de hidrogênio, um radical hidroxila ou um grupo C~ 1~-C~ 8~ hidrocarbiloxi; <B>1<D> é 1, 2 ou 3; <B>v<D> é o número de oxidação do metal <B>M<D>, b) um metaloceno da fórmula geral (2): <B>(C~ p~Y)~ m~M'X'~ n~Z~ o~<D> em que cada <B>C~ p~Y<D> é o mesmo ou diferente e é um de um ligante mono- ou poli- substituído, fundido ou não fundido, homo ou heterocíclico ciclopentadienil, indenil, tetrahidroindenil, fluorenil, ou octahidrofluorenil, ligante que é substituído no seu anel ciclopentadienil com pelo menos um substituinte <B>Y<D> que é um de um radical -OR', -SR', -NR'~ 2~, -C(H ou R')=, ou -PR'~ 2~, cada R' sendo o mesmo ou diferente e sendo um de um grupo hidrocarbil C~ 1~-C~ 16~, um grupo tri-C~ 1~-C~ 8~ hidrocarbil silil ou um grupo tri-C~ 1~-C~ 8~ hidrocarbiloxi silil; <B>M'<D> é um metal de transição do Grupo 4 da Tabela Periódica e ligado ao ligange <B>C~ p~Y<D> pelo menos em um modo de ligação <B><sym>5<D>; cada <B>X'<D> é o mesmo ou diferente e é um de átomo de hidrogênio, um átomo de halogênio, um grupo hidrocarbil C~ 1~-C~ 8~, um grupo hidrocarbil heteroátomo C~ 1~-C~ 8~ ou um grupo tri-C~ 1~-C~ 8~ hidrocarbil silil ou dois <B>X'<D> formam um anel um com o outro; <B>Z<D> é um átomo de ponte ou grupo entre dois ligantes <B>C~ p~Y<D> ou um ligante <B>C~ p~Y<D> e o metal de transição <B>M'<D>; <B>m<D> é 1 ou 2; <B>o<D> é 0 ou 1; e <B>n<D> é <B>4-m<D> se não existe nenhuma ponte <B>Z<D> ou <B>Z<D> é uma ponte entre dois ligantes <B>C~ p~Y<D>, ou <B>n<D> é <B>4-m-o<D> se <B>Z<D> é uma ponte entre um ligante <B>C~ p~Y<D> e o metal de transição <B>M'<D>, e c) um aluminoxano da seguinte fórmula geral (3): em que cada <B>R''<D> e cada <B>R'''<D> é o mesmo ou diferente e é um grupo alquil C~ 2~-C~ 10~; e <B>p<D> é um inteiro entre 1 e 40; e recuperando a referida composição catalítica suportada de polimerização de olefina.
